Read Aloud Extension is described as 'Read aloud the content of any web page with one click using this browser extension for desktop and mobile browsers. Capable of reading in different languages. Speed, pitch and other settings available' and is a Text to Speech service in the web browsers category. There are more than 50 alternatives to Read Aloud Extension for a variety of platforms, including Windows, Web-based, Mac, iPhone and Android apps. The best Read Aloud Extension alternative is ElevenReader, which is free. Other great apps like Read Aloud Extension are NaturalReader, Kokoro, eSpeak and TextAloud.
